Teaching Personnel are currently seeking a dedicated and compassionate Teaching Assistant to join a welcoming primary school in Blackpool from September 2026.

This rewarding role involves providing 1:1 support for pupils with Special Educational Needs (SEN), helping them access learning, develop confidence, and achieve their full potential within a supportive school environment.

  • Providing tailored 1:1 support for pupils with additional needs.
  • Supporting children both in and out of the classroom.
  • Assisting with learning activities and promoting engagement.
  • Working closely with the class teacher and SENCO to implement support plans.
  • Supporting pupils with personal care needs where required.
  • Encouraging social, emotional, and academic development.
  • Has experience working with children with SEN, either in schools or other support settings.
  • Is comfortable providing personal care.
  • Demonstrates patience, empathy, and a nurturing approach.
  • Can build positive relationships with pupils, staff, and parents.
  • Is reliable, committed, and able to work effectively as part of a team.
